网站浏览器兼容,wordpress文章增加新字段,网站开发建设赚钱吗,黑黄logo网站1.1 当前用户专有的启动文件夹
该文件夹是许多应用软件自动启动的常用位置#xff0c;在当前登录用户下#xff0c;Windows会自动启动该文件夹内的所有快捷方式1。用户启动文件夹一般在#xff1a; 系统盘#xff3c;Documents and Settings#xff3c;当前登录的用户…1.1 当前用户专有的启动文件夹
该文件夹是许多应用软件自动启动的常用位置在当前登录用户下Windows会自动启动该文件夹内的所有快捷方式1。用户启动文件夹一般在 系统盘Documents and Settings当前登录的用户账户名称「开始」菜单程序启动。
每一个登录用户都对应一个这样的文件夹会加载其中的自动程序。
1.2 对所有用户有效的启动文件夹
无论登录者是谁该文件夹下的程序都会自启动。该文件夹一般在 系统盘Documents and SettingsAll Users「开始」菜单程序启动。
对应的注册表位置 [H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\ShellFolders] Startup\%Directory%\
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User ShellFolders] Startup\%Directory%\
其中%Directory%为启动文件夹位置。
2. 注册表子键
2.1 Load
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indowsNTCurrentVersionWindowsload
Windows XP Professional该子键的位置如下图所示
2.2 Userinit
通常该注册键下面有一个userinit.exe但这个键允许指定用逗号分隔的多个程序例如userinit.exe、OSA.exe。
位置 H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sNTCurrentVersionWinlogonUserinit
Windows XP Professional该子键的位置如下图所示
2.3 ExplorerRun
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ionPoliciesExplorerRun 对当前用户生效2
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ionPoliciesExplorerRun 对所有用户生效
2.4 RunServicesOnce
用来启动服务程序启动时间在用户登录之前而且先于其他通过注册键启动的程序。
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indows CurrentVersionRunServicesOnce
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ionRunServicesOnce
2.5 RunServices
RunServices注册键指定的程序紧接RunServicesOnce指定的程序之后运行启动时间也在用户登录之前。
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ionRunServices
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ows CurrentVersionRunServices
2.6 RunOnceSetup
RunOnceSetup指定了用户登录之后运行的程序。
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ersion RunOnceSetup
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ionRunOnceSetup
2.7 RunOnce
安装程序通常用RunOnce键自动运行程序。
位置 H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ionRunOnce
H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ionRunOnce
HKEY_LOCAL_MACHINE下面的RunOnce键会在用户登录之后立即运行程序运行时机在其他Run键指定的程序之前。HKEY_CURRENT_USER下面的RunOnce键在操作系统处理其他Run键以及“启动”文件夹的内容之后运行。Windows XP系统下还有注册键H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ows CurrentVersionRunOnceEx
2.8 Run
Run是自动运行程序最常用的注册键。
位置 H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ionRun
HKEY_LOCAL_MACHINESoftwareMicrosoftWindowsCurrentVersionRun
HKEY_CURRENT_USER下面的Run键紧接HKEY_LOCAL_MACHINE下面的Run键运行,但两者都在处理“启动”文件夹之前。
2.9 Windows中加载的服务
这里加载的服务具有最高的优先级。
位置 H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services
这里面的Start键的值确定了服务的启动状态2表示自动运行3表示手动运行4表示禁止。
2.10 Windows Shell
Windows Shell 位于H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Winlogon下面的Shell字符串类型键值中默认值为Explorer.exe
2.11 BootExecute
属于启动执行的一个项目系统通过它来实现启动Native程序Native程序在驱动程序和系统核心加载后将被加载此时会话管理器smss.exe进行Windows NT用户模式并开始顺序启动Native程序。
它位于注册表中HKEY_LOCAL_MACHINE\System\ControlSet001\Control\Session Manager下有一个BootExecute键用于系统启动时的某些自动检查。这个启动项里的程序是在系统图形界面完成前就被执行的具有很高的优先级。
2.12 组策略加载程序
在Windows 2000/XP/Vista/Windows7中在“运行”对话框输入“Gpedit.msc”打开组策略展开“用户配置”-“管理模板”-“系统”-“登录”就可以看到用户设置的登录时运行的项目双击“在用户登录时运行这些程序”单击“显示”按钮即可查看自启动程序3。相应的键值在H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\GroupPolicy Objects\本地User\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er\Run中可看到。
2.13 其他注册表键值
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\System\Shell]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\ShellServiceObjectDelayLoad]
[HKEY_CURRENT_USER\Software\Policies\Microsoft\Windows\System\Scripts]
[H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\System\Scripts]
最后
自我介绍一下小编13年上海交大毕业曾经在小公司待过也去过华为、OPPO等大厂18年进入阿里一直到现在。
深知大多数网络安全工程师想要提升技能往往是自己摸索成长但自己不成体系的自学效果低效又漫长而且极易碰到天花板技术停滞不前
因此收集整理了一份《2024年网络安全全套学习资料》初衷也很简单就是希望能够帮助到想自学提升又不知道该从何学起的朋友。 既有适合小白学习的零基础资料也有适合3年以上经验的小伙伴深入学习提升的进阶课程基本涵盖了95%以上网络安全知识点真正的体系化
如果你觉得这些内容对你有帮助需要这份全套学习资料的朋友可以戳我获取
由于文件比较大这里只是将部分目录截图出来每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频并且会持续更新
3年以上经验的小伙伴深入学习提升的进阶课程基本涵盖了95%以上网络安全知识点真正的体系化**
如果你觉得这些内容对你有帮助需要这份全套学习资料的朋友可以戳我获取
由于文件比较大这里只是将部分目录截图出来每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频并且会持续更新